TICKET-FNT-209: Vault lockout blocking font vendoring PR

The Hollybrook asset vault locked itself during the nightly sync, so the vendored copies of the Marrowtype font families can't be pulled into the repo. The vendoring PR is otherwise ready for review — licensing notes are in the attached manifest. To unlock the vault and finish the checksum verification, enter the recovery passphrase below.

unlock words, fadug-tageg: zorix-wenwyn-quenmir